Benefits of Kiln Dried Firewood: Less Work, More Heat

Switching to kiln-dried logs offers a significant improvement for homeowners who use a fireplace . Traditionally , cutting and drying firewood can be a laborious task, requiring considerable time. Kiln-dried logs , however, arrives with a low water content, meaning less time and exertion are needed on handling . Furthermore, because its decreased moisture content , kiln-dried firewood burns significantly more thoroughly, producing more BTU's and leading to a hotter environment. You’ll even experience less soot deposits, preventing chimney accumulation and reducing the possibility of dangerous smoke.

Understanding Hardwood Firewood Types & Their Burning Qualities

Selecting the right wood for your hearth can drastically impact your warmth and the total ambiance . Hardwoods, such as red oak, hard maple, ash , river birch, and pecan hickory, generally provide better burning properties compared to softwoods. They tend to ignite slower , producing a greater amount of thermal energy and a extended flame duration . Still, some variety has its distinct advantages ; for instance, hickory is known for its intense heat, while ash offers a relatively tidy burn. Proper curing – reducing the dampness to approximately 20% – is vital for all hardwood types to ensure optimal burning efficiency .
